Oregon Code § ORS 65.177

Delegates

(1) A corporation may provide in the corporations articles of incorporation or bylaws for delegates having some or all of the authority of members.
(2) The articles of incorporation or bylaws may set forth provisions relating to:
(a) The characteristics, qualifications, rights, limitations and obligations of delegates, including the selection and removal of delegates;
(b) Providing notice to and calling, holding and conducting meetings of delegates; and
(c) Carrying on corporate activities during and between meetings of delegates.
